Sharp 1859 Dollar, PR63 Cameo
1859 $1 PR63 Cameo PCGS. 1859 was the first year during which proof Seated dollars were publicly offered, although proofs are known of all P-mint issues in the series. Despite a comparatively generous mintage of 800 pieces, proofs with any sort of cameo contrast are scarce and bring a nice premium over their uncontrasted counterparts. This is a sharply struck proof, with light splashes of burgundy color over mirrored fields, tending toward indigo at the rims, and a degree of contrast more pronounced on the reverse. The few marks noted on the surfaces are trivial and do not affect the eye appeal in the slightest.From The Findley Collection.(Registry values: N2998)
